小编for*_*rtm的帖子

gpg解密失败,没有密钥错误

我有一个gpg .key文件,用作解密.dat.pgp文件的密码.使用以下命令在一台服务器上使用相同的.key文件成功解密加密的.data.pgp文件

cat xxx_gpg.key | /usr/bin/gpg --batch --quiet -o xxx.dat --passphrase-fd O -d xxx.dat.pgp
Run Code Online (Sandbox Code Playgroud)

但是,当我将相同的密钥移动到另一个服务器xxx_gpg.key并运行相同的上述命令时,我得到以下错误 -

gpg: decryption failed: No secret key
Run Code Online (Sandbox Code Playgroud)

编辑:

我发现它gpg --list-secret-keys返回服务器上的一些数据,但是没有为其他服务器返回结果.

我们如何配置密钥

unix encryption gnupg public-key-encryption

32
推荐指数
6
解决办法
9万
查看次数

在EC2上使用vagrant

我需要在EC2上设置Web服务器和数据库服务器.以后应该很容易迁移到其他服务提供商.

目前,我有一个Web服务器和一个数据库服务器,每个服务器都运行在单独的EC2微实例上,远程安装了软件.

我们可以在这些微型实例上使用预安装和预配置的软件(如LAMP堆栈)运行一个流浪盒,并使用它.所以我将以2个流浪盒结束,一个用于Web服务器另一个用于数据库服务器.

亚马逊已经提供了复制实例的方法,但它可能只是复制到另一个EC2实例.如果需要移动到其他某个提供程序,它将是重新安装所有实例的过程.因此,亚马逊的虚拟盒子上安装了一个自己的虚拟盒子就是我正在研究的内容.

我不知道它有多好或多坏.我怀疑这是否会影响性能.请分享您的观点.目标是在本地准备env,并且可以灵活地在任何服务提供商上轻松部署它.

amazon-ec2 vagrant

23
推荐指数
1
解决办法
2万
查看次数

babel-preset-es2015中指定的插件0提供了_c的无效属性

通过以下配置获得上述错误,注释passPerPreset会删除错误.有没有配置丢失?

.babelrc:

{
  "passPerPreset": true,
  "presets": [{
      "plugins": [
        "./build/babelRelayPlugin",
        "transform-runtime",
        "transform-es2015-classes"
      ]
    }, "es2015", "stage-0", "react"],
  "env": {
     "development": {
      "presets": ["react-hmre"]
    }
  }
}
Run Code Online (Sandbox Code Playgroud)

package.json:

"babel-cli": "^6.5.1",
"babel-core": "^6.5.2",
"babel-eslint": "^4.1.8",
"babel-loader": "^6.2.2",
"babel-plugin-react-transform": "^2.0.0",
"babel-plugin-transform-es2015-classes": "^6.5.2",
"babel-plugin-transform-runtime": "^6.5.2",
"babel-polyfill": "^6.5.0",
"babel-preset-es2015": "^6.5.0",
"babel-preset-react": "^6.5.0",
"babel-preset-react-hmre": "^1.1.0",
"babel-preset-stage-0": "^6.5.0",
"babel-relay-plugin": "^0.7.0",
"babel-runtime": "^6.5.0",
Run Code Online (Sandbox Code Playgroud)

Webpack:

module: {
    loaders: [        
    {
      loader: "babel-loader",
      include: [
        path.resolve(__dirname, "app"),
      ],
      test: /\.jsx?$/,
      query: {
        plugins: ['transform-runtime'],
        presets: ['react', 'es2015', 'stage-0'],
      }
    }, …
Run Code Online (Sandbox Code Playgroud)

babeljs

13
推荐指数
3
解决办法
9354
查看次数

Ember mixin作为接口

Ember对象可以使用mupltiple mixins吗?我认为mixin相当于Java中的接口,在这种情况下应该提供在这里实现许多mixin -

App.Movie = Ember.Object.extend(App.FirstMixin, { .. });
Run Code Online (Sandbox Code Playgroud)

如果还有SecondMixin,该对象如何使用它?

ember.js

10
推荐指数
1
解决办法
2510
查看次数

使用自动完成功能创建TextField

我必须在Ember中创建一个带有自动完成功能TextField,以便在每次按键时根据匹配从数据库中获取数据.

他们在Ember中的任何内置小部件都是这样吗?

ember.js

9
推荐指数
2
解决办法
7607
查看次数

如何添加Spring Data REST投影的链接?

我创建了一个Spring Data Rest投影(不是摘录投影),只需要添加一些链接,因为这些链接与同一实体的其他投影和实体本身不具有重要意义.

据我所知,我们怎么能这样做ResourceProcessor呢?我只能添加链接到实体,是否可以只为该投影添加链接?

spring-data spring-data-rest

9
推荐指数
1
解决办法
2527
查看次数

在Spring Data REST中使用嵌套预测

如何获得预期输出低于OrderProjection使用ItemProjection使用Spring Data REST呈现Items的位置

GET/orders/1?projection = with_items

预测:

@Projection(name = "summary", types = Item.class)
public interface ItemProjection {
    String getName();
}

@Projection(name = "with_item", types = Order.class)
public interface OrderProjection {
    LocalDateTime getOrderedDate();
    Status getStatus();
    Set<ItemProjection> getItems(); // this is marshalling as Set<Item> (full Item graph)
}
Run Code Online (Sandbox Code Playgroud)

目前获得输出:

{
  "status" : "PAYMENT_EXPECTED",
  "orderedDate" : "2014-11-09T11:33:02.823",
  "items" : [ {
    "name" : "Java Chip",
    "quantity" : 1,
    "milk" : "SEMI",
    "size" : "LARGE",
    "price" : {
      "currency" : "EUR",
      "value" : 4.20 …
Run Code Online (Sandbox Code Playgroud)

java spring spring-data-rest

8
推荐指数
1
解决办法
3748
查看次数

如何在Spring Data REST中公开@EmbeddedId转换器

有些实体具有复合主键,并且这些实体在公开时具有错误的链接,在_links中的URL中具有类的完全限定名称

点击链接也会出现这样的错误 -

org.springframework.core.convert.ConverterNotFoundException: No converter found capable of converting from type java.lang.String to type com.core.connection.domains.UserFriendshipId
Run Code Online (Sandbox Code Playgroud)

我有XML配置的Spring Repository和jpa:启用了存储库,还有从JpaRepository扩展的Respository

我可以使用Repository实现org.springframework.core.convert.converter.Converter来处理这个问题.目前获得如下链接 -

_links: {
userByFriendshipId: {
href: "http://localhost:8080/api/userFriendships/com.core.connection.domains.UserFriendshipId@5b10/userByFriendId"
}
Run Code Online (Sandbox Code Playgroud)

在xml配置中,我在存储库中启用了jpa:repositories和@RestResource

java spring spring-data spring-data-rest

7
推荐指数
1
解决办法
5536
查看次数

从chrome调试Ember.js

当我尝试从chrome浏览器调试Ember.js时,只有按下f5,它的application.js断点才会保留,并且会在页面刷新时删除其余部分.

我在控制台选项卡中启用了"Log XMLHTTP Requests"和"Preserve Log Upon Navigation".问题仍然存在..

有帮助吗?

google-chrome google-chrome-devtools ember.js

5
推荐指数
1
解决办法
3807
查看次数

在MySQL表上并发READ和WRITE

如果经常从前端写入表,并且同样的表也必须经常搜索.两者都是性能关键.

例如,可在其" 内容 "列上搜索具有全文索引的POST表?如果很少有用户在撰写帖子,则会转到同一个表,然后其他用户会在同一时间搜索关键字.

Will UPDATE/INSERT operation lock SELECT queries in above case ?
Run Code Online (Sandbox Code Playgroud)

数据库 - MySQL

mysql sql

5
推荐指数
1
解决办法
6962
查看次数